External cleaning
Clean the external surfaces of the machine
and control panel
with
a damp soft cloth. If
necessary use only
neutral
detergents. Never
use abrasive products, scouring pads or sol-
vent (acetone,
trichloroethylene etc
...
).
Internal
cleaning
Ensure that
the seals around the door, the
detergent
and rinse aid dispensers are
cleaned
regularly
with
a damp
cloth.
We
recommend every
3
months
you
run the
wash
programme for heavy soiled
dishes
us-
ing
detergent
but
without
dishes.
Prolonged periods of non-operation
If
you
are
not
using
the
machine for a pro-
longed
period
of time
you
are advised to:
1.
Unplug the appliance and then turn
off
the
water.
2.
Leave
the door ajar to prevent the forma-
tion of any unpleasant smells.
3. Leave
the
inside
of the machine
clean.
Frost precautions
Avoid
placing the machine
in a location
where
the
temperature
is
below
ao
c.
If this
is
unavoidable, empty the machine, close the
appliance
door, disconnect the
water
inlet
pipe and empty it.
